An Indian techie’s post advocating the merits of job hustle past midnight hours polarised people on social media this Saturday, November 15. Kartikey Verma, employed at developer shipping in a tech company, shared a photograph of himself, busy at work as early as 2 AM. In his post shared on X, Verma seemed to promote the benefits of working at pre-dawn time.
“There’s something about 2-6 am. The world sleeps, distractions die, and the work finally breathes,” Verma wrote in a caption to his post, containing a black and white image of him busy operating on his laptop and tech system.
Techie Promotes Pre-Dawn Time Hustle
Completely breaking from the norm of working for extensive hours from morning to evening and taking a good night’s sleep before resuming,
Verma backed the advantages of working between 2 AM and 6 AM in his post. The techie insisted it was this time of the day that best allowed him to focus on his tasks without facing any distractions as the rest of the world went to sleep.
There’s something about 2-6am.
The world sleeps, distractions die, and the work finally breathes pic.twitter.com/l8l5tjLBXT— Kartikey Verma (@KartikeyStack) November 15, 2025
Verma, whose LinkedIn profile confirmed he worked with Warmwind OS, is currently the founding engineer of Sendit Zone. His post promoting a work hustle at unusual hours past midnight divided users on social media.
‘Don’t Romanticise Sleep Deprivation’
Various social media users criticised the techie for promoting an unhealthy obsession with work at the cost of sleep and compromising on one’s lifestyle.
“This is giving main character syndrome but also lowkey relatable ngl, late night productivity hits different but don’t romanticise sleep deprivation,” wrote an individual.
To which Verma replied: “I agree, sleep is very important and I always try to get an ample amount of sleep.”
Someone else said, “Trust me, I tried this for one week. I completely ruined my mental and physical health. Sleep at night and work in the morning and evening. That’s what has worked for me.”
“I also excel in the late nights, total silence and real clear thinking,” a rare user supported Verma in the debate.
Someone mentioned, “This is a lie. I have proof.”
At a time when medical experts are raising an alert against sleep deprivation and relentless work, Verma’s post did raise eyebrows for promoting a pre-dawn work stint and focusing purely on professional goals.
